How to write 50 hundredths
NeX [460]

50 hundredths as a Fraction

Since 50 hundredths is 50 over one hundred, 50 hundredths as a Fraction is 50/100.



50 hundredths as a Decimal

If you divide 50 by one hundred you get 50 hundredths as a decimal which is 0.50.




50 hundredths as a Percent

To get 50 hundredths as a Percent, you multiply the decimal with 100 to get the answer of 50 percent.
